Basic Anatomy for Coders

Both the CPT® and ICD-9-CM manuals are arranged and organized by the body?s anatomical systems. When a code doesn?t seem to refer to a specific area of the body, you?ll still need to know how the body is arranged to properly use these codes.
Consequently, anyone who assigns codes or audits coding must firmly grasp anatomy and physiology.
